Abstract
Disclosed herein are spinel-type spherical black iron oxide particles containing 1.5 to 17.0 wt % of Zn, and having a specific surface area of 5 to 15 m2 /g, a magnetization of not less than 70 emu/g in an external magnetic field of 1 kOe and a coercive force (Hc) of not more than the value obtained from the following expression:
Hc(Oe)=15+3×(specific surface area of the particles).
and a process for producing the same.

5. A process for producing spinel-type spherical black iron oxide particles having the formula:
space="preserve" listing-type="equation">Zn.sub.x Fe.sub.1-x O.Fe.sub.2 O.sub.3
-
6. wherein x is a number in the range of 0.05 to 0.62, said particles containing 1.5 to 17.0 wt % of Zn, and having a specific surface area of 5 to 15 m2 /g, a magnetization of not less than 70 emu/g in an external magnetic field of 1 kOe and a coercive force (Hc) of not more than the value obtained from the following expression:
-
space="preserve" listing-type="equation">Hc(Oe)=15+3×
(specific surface area of the particles),said process comprising the steps of; (a) preparing a mixed suspension which contains ferrous hydroxide and sufficient zinc hydroxide to produce black iron oxide particles containing 1.5 to 17.0 wt % zinc by weight based upon the product and which has a pH of 6 to 9 in a non-oxidizing atmosphere by using an aqueous ferrous salt solution, a zinc compound and an aqueous alkaline solution; and (b) oxidizing the ferrous hydroxide by blowing an oxygen-containing gas into the mixed suspension so as to oxidize ferrous hydroxide until the pH reaches a value in the range of 4 to 6 and the oxidation degree is such that Fe3+ in the mixed suspension is 60 to 70 mol % based on the total amount of iron and zinc in the oxidation step.
